What the strongest evidence actually shows
Researchers have tested many popular anti-aging supplements in people. The pattern is clear. Some products move a few markers in the right direction. Few, if any, change the big outcomes that define aging in real life. That means no proven gains in lifespan, no solid shifts in validated biological-age clocks, and no broad drops in age-related disease. The claim that supplements reverse aging does not match human data. Modest, endpoint-specific benefits do appear for a handful of compounds.
Collagen is the classic case study. A large review of randomized trials in humans found better skin hydration, elasticity, and fewer wrinkles with oral collagen. The same review concluded there is no solid clinical evidence that collagen prevents or treats skin aging as a whole. That is a huge gap between “my skin looks a bit better” and “I am aging slower.” Enjoy the cosmetic boost if you want it. Do not expect collagen to move your lifespan or your joints decades forward.
Nicotinamide adenine dinucleotide hype meets human outcomes
Compounds that boost nicotinamide adenine dinucleotide, like nicotinamide mononucleotide and nicotinamide riboside, raise blood nicotinamide adenine dinucleotide levels in humans. That shows clear biological activity. Clinical benefits that matter to aging remain unproven. A systematic review described the wellness and anti-aging outcome data as inconclusive. Raising a molecule is easy. Turning that change into more strength, better function, or longer life is the hard part we have not cracked yet.
Claims that these boosters improve real-world performance have not held up under pooled testing. A synthesis of randomized trials in older adults found no significant gains in muscle strength or physical performance from nicotinamide adenine dinucleotide precursors. That matters more than any lab marker. If a pill does not help you move better, climb stairs, or carry groceries, then it is not solving the aging problem you actually feel day to day.
Antioxidants, vitamins, and the healthspan reframing
Antioxidant pills once looked like a simple fix. Strong trials in humans have not shown lifespan gains from high-dose antioxidant supplements. Some trials even tied heavy dosing to higher health risks. That track record argues for common sense: get antioxidants from food first, and be wary of megadoses in a bottle that promise miracles. Diet patterns outperform single molecules sold as shortcuts to longevity.
Broader reviews of supplements and natural products point to a more grounded aim: support healthspan. Many nutrients help you stay functional longer, even if they do not add years to the clock. Enough vitamin D, B vitamins, vitamin K, calcium, zinc, and omega-3 fats aligns with better aging paths. That is not razzle-dazzle. It is the basics, done right, over time. Pill promises fade; steady habits win.
Skin, signals, and the surrogate endpoint trap
Skin outcomes often lead the headlines because they change fast and photograph well. Reviews report that collagen and some polyphenols can ease signs of skin photoaging and improve measures like elasticity compared with placebo. Yet several trendy picks, like hyaluronic acid or certain carotenoids, do not show clear benefit in controlled trials. A smoother cheek in twelve weeks does not equal a younger body. Surrogate outcomes can mislead when they stand in for aging itself.

Practical buyers should ask three blunt questions. First, what is the exact human outcome improved, and by how much? Second, does that change persist after you stop taking it? Third, does the effect scale to things you care about—walking speed, grip strength, hospital stays, and survival? If the evidence hangs on a lab number or a selfie, keep your wallet closed. If it moves function in older adults, then it earns a look.
How to build a sane supplement stack
Start with the “boring” wins. Cover dietary gaps with food first, then consider simple, proven add-ons with your clinician. Omega-3 fats, vitamin D when deficient, and adequate protein support muscle, heart, and brain aging. Creatine can help strength and daily function in older adults when paired with training. These tools target healthspan, not immortality. That frame respects both the science and the budget. It also reflects basic conservative values: evidence, prudence, and personal responsibility.
Bottom line for shoppers with big hopes
Most anti-aging supplements are overhyped. A few deliver modest, specific benefits in humans, such as collagen for certain skin measures. Nicotinamide adenine dinucleotide boosters raise the molecule but have not proven real-world anti-aging effects. Antioxidant megadoses have not extended life and can backfire. Shift goals from rewinding the clock to staying strong, sharp, and independent longer. Choose habits and supplements that help you do that, and skip the fairy tales.
